summaryrefslogtreecommitdiffstats
path: root/generic
Commit message (Expand)AuthorAgeFilesLines
* Merge 8.7jan.nijtmans2022-07-021-45/+109
|\
| * TIP #607: -failindex option for encoding convertto/convertfromjan.nijtmans2022-07-021-45/+109
| |\
| | * Merge 8.7jan.nijtmans2022-06-1569-1126/+2060
| | |\
| | * \ Merge 8.7. Renumber testcases in cmdAH.test.jan.nijtmans2022-03-214-22/+21
| | |\ \
| | * \ \ Rebase towards 8.7jan.nijtmans2022-03-171-45/+110
| | |\ \ \
| | | * | | Eliminate "deprecated" constraint: doens't exist in 9.0 any more. Also remove...jan.nijtmans2022-03-171-1/+1
| | | * | | TIP607 encoding failindex: merge trunk. Correct the remaining use of TCL_ENCO...oehhar2022-03-174-50/+22
| | | |\ \ \
| | | * | | | TIP607 encoding failindex: also implement encoding convertto, move tests to c...oehhar2022-03-171-28/+61
| | | * | | | Merge 9.0jan.nijtmans2022-03-174-14/+14
| | | |\ \ \ \
| | | * \ \ \ \ merge trunkoehhar2022-03-167-39/+40
| | | |\ \ \ \ \
| | | * \ \ \ \ \ TIP607 encoding failindex: get work out of 8.7 branch to this 9.0 branch. TIP...oehhar2022-03-141-22/+54
| | | |\ \ \ \ \ \
| | | | * | | | | | TIP607 encoding failindex: some tests and implementation (not working)oehhar2022-03-141-13/+24
| | | | * | | | | | TIP607 encoding failindex: options -failindex and -nocomplain may not both be...tip607-encoding-failindexoehhar2022-03-141-38/+29
| | | | * | | | | | TIP607 encoding failindex: start implementationtip601-encoding-failindexoehhar2022-03-141-18/+48
| | | * | | | | | | Merge mainoehhar2022-03-141-6/+6
| | | |\ \ \ \ \ \ \
| | | * \ \ \ \ \ \ \ TIP605 encoding failindex: prepare TCL 9.0 main branch with branch "encodings...oehhar2022-03-146-43/+239
| | | |\ \ \ \ \ \ \ \ | | | | | |/ / / / / / | | | | |/| | | | | |
* | | | | | | | | | | Merge 8.7jan.nijtmans2022-07-011-3/+3
|\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/ /
| * | | | | | | | | | Merge 8.6jan.nijtmans2022-07-012-4/+4
| |\ \ \ \ \ \ \ \ \ \
| | * | | | | | | | | | Test for TclOO 1.1.0. Remove some useless type-castsjan.nijtmans2022-07-012-3/+3
| * | | | | | | | | | | Fix [b79df322a9]: Tcl_NewUnicodeObj truncates stringsjan.nijtmans2022-06-301-1/+1
| * | | | | | | | | | | Merge 8.6jan.nijtmans2022-06-243-9/+9
| |\ \ \ \ \ \ \ \ \ \ \ | | |/ / / / / / / / / /
| | * | | | | | | | | | typo'sjan.nijtmans2022-06-242-3/+3
* | |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-241-0/+5
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| Resolve the TODO: What's going on here? Document or eliminate.jan.nijtmans2022-06-243-14/+13
* | | | | | | | | | | | Use TCL_MAJOR_VERSION to document (kind of) what's the difference between Tcl...jan.nijtmans2022-06-241-2/+14
* | |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-242-18/+18
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| Don't use TCL_HASH_TYPE for epoch/refCount type variables, keep it the same a...jan.nijtmans2022-06-247-30/+28
* | |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-242-1/+9
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| Put back seemingly useless typedefs (yes, there are picky compilers)jan.nijtmans2022-06-241-0/+8
| * | | | | | | | | | | Don't use (unsigned)-1 -> TCL_INDEX_NONEjan.nijtmans2022-06-242-6/+6
* | |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-233-34/+34
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| more "unsigned int" -> TCL_HASH_TYPEjan.nijtmans2022-06-233-34/+34
* | |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-231-2/+3
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| Restore NS_DEAD flag value (from 0x04 back to 0x02, how it was in Tcl 8.6). I...jan.nijtmans2022-06-231-2/+3
* | | | | | | | | | | | Merge 8.7. Update documentationjan.nijtmans2022-06-234-12/+12
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| Merge 8.6jan.nijtmans2022-06-231-1/+1
| |\ \ \ \ \ \ \ \ \ \ \ | | |/ / / / / / / / / /
| | * | | | | | | | | | Slightly better integer overflow handling in Tcl_ListObjReplace()jan.nijtmans2022-06-231-1/+1
* | |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-231-8/+0
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| Remove unused typedef'sjan.nijtmans2022-06-231-8/+0
| * | | | | | | | | | | Use "void *" in stead of ClientData in tclInt.decs/tclOO.decls (backported fr...jan.nijtmans2022-06-235-71/+70
* | |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-232-32/+32
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| Use TCL_HASH_TYPE in stead of "unsigned int", wherever the Tcl 9.0 type is "s...jan.nijtmans2022-06-232-27/+27
| * | | | | | | | | | | Use "void *" in stead of ClientData in tclDecls.h (backported from 9.0)jan.nijtmans2022-06-232-225/+211
* | | | | | | | | | | | Fix (internal) TclFindElement() signature (int -> size_t)jan.nijtmans2022-06-203-13/+11
* | |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-201-1/+1
|\ \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/ / /
| * | | | | | | | | | | Unneeded type-castjan.nijtmans2022-06-201-1/+1
| | |_|_|_|_|_|_|_|_|/ | |/| | | | | | | | |
| * | | | | | | | | | Add comments in tcl.declsjan.nijtmans2022-06-151-0/+3
* | | | | | | | | | | Remove the Tcl_GetByteArrayFromObj/TclGetByteArrayFromObj stub entries: Those...jan.nijtmans2022-06-154-54/+29
* | | | | | | | | | | Merge 8.7jan.nijtmans2022-06-151-0/+2
|\ \ \ \ \ \ \ \ \ \ \ | |/ / / / / / / / / /
| * | | | | | | | | | Backport tclStubLib.c from Tcl 9.0 (they should be equal in 8.7 and 9.0)jan.nijtmans2022-06-151-1/+8